Branch: refs/heads/master
Home: https://github.com/tribe29/checkmk
Commit: cc3960356df4ac92c61f306b4fa031df3263155c
https://github.com/tribe29/checkmk/commit/cc3960356df4ac92c61f306b4fa031df3…
Author: Max Linke <max.linke(a)tribe29.com>
Date: 2022-03-08 (Tue, 08 Mar 2022)
Changed paths:
M cmk/base/plugins/agent_based/utils/gcp.py
M cmk/special_agents/agent_gcp.py
M tests/unit/cmk/special_agents/test_agent_gcp.py
M tests/unit/test_pipfile.py
Log Message:
-----------
Clean up gcp api integration
All check plugins now use the asset section. This is the only source for
labels. So we remove anything related to labels not connected to the
assets section.
Change-Id: I81513a7feeba964a352f6b67ea9e7fc6c43fbe8a
Commit: aed7014070d93595717bcb059e51efa36d656155
https://github.com/tribe29/checkmk/commit/aed7014070d93595717bcb059e51efa36…
Author: Max Linke <max.linke(a)tribe29.com>
Date: 2022-03-08 (Tue, 08 Mar 2022)
Changed paths:
M Pipfile
M Pipfile.lock
M tests/unit/test_pipfile.py
Log Message:
-----------
clean up unused dependencies
Change-Id: Icfff19b4fe93805224d03d6334277163c0e07163
Compare: https://github.com/tribe29/checkmk/compare/98daf3a66704...aed7014070d9
Branch: refs/heads/2.1.0
Home: https://github.com/tribe29/checkmk
Commit: 7403210bf12c31b00731f22c2cb2c89e8b1c3b07
https://github.com/tribe29/checkmk/commit/7403210bf12c31b00731f22c2cb2c89e8…
Author: Max Linke <max.linke(a)tribe29.com>
Date: 2022-03-08 (Tue, 08 Mar 2022)
Changed paths:
A .werks/13772
Log Message:
-----------
13772 Add Google Cloud Platform support
Add support for Google Cloud Platform. Monitored services
- Google Cloud Storage (GCS)
Change-Id: Ic23e2c5d0d2c533ae5634bb9eccae458a785eeaa
Branch: refs/heads/master
Home: https://github.com/tribe29/checkmk
Commit: 50d24918f5ad4918ad3a39be7b58ef1d1bd7e71a
https://github.com/tribe29/checkmk/commit/50d24918f5ad4918ad3a39be7b58ef1d1…
Author: Max Linke <max.linke(a)tribe29.com>
Date: 2022-03-08 (Tue, 08 Mar 2022)
Changed paths:
A cmk/base/plugins/agent_based/gcp_assets.py
M cmk/base/plugins/agent_based/gcp_gcs.py
M cmk/base/plugins/agent_based/utils/gcp.py
M tests/unit/cmk/base/plugins/agent_based/test_gcp_gcs.py
Log Message:
-----------
Update GCS Check Plugin to use new assets section
- update gcp utility library as well
Change-Id: I925ede6e12adfb0809cd8637fd116b0f32e22de2
Commit: 806a4792d7549086527cc5e068a566130e5030dd
https://github.com/tribe29/checkmk/commit/806a4792d7549086527cc5e068a566130…
Author: Max Linke <max.linke(a)tribe29.com>
Date: 2022-03-08 (Tue, 08 Mar 2022)
Changed paths:
M cmk/base/plugins/agent_based/gcp_function.py
M tests/unit/cmk/base/plugins/agent_based/test_gcp_function.py
Log Message:
-----------
update cloud function check plugin to use assets
Change-Id: I3b0bb14236509f6be6c69b03bbaa9248f3e6eae4
Commit: 58fecfa58ee398a5353dc4a1327ef129187d847b
https://github.com/tribe29/checkmk/commit/58fecfa58ee398a5353dc4a1327ef1291…
Author: Max Linke <max.linke(a)tribe29.com>
Date: 2022-03-08 (Tue, 08 Mar 2022)
Changed paths:
M cmk/base/plugins/agent_based/gcp_run.py
M tests/unit/cmk/base/plugins/agent_based/test_gcp_run.py
Log Message:
-----------
update cloud run check plugin to use asset section
Change-Id: Ia1bbeaee518f89b2dee902bb668e6a9a5b32b898
Compare: https://github.com/tribe29/checkmk/compare/420eb9f48cde...58fecfa58ee3
Branch: refs/heads/2.1.0
Home: https://github.com/tribe29/checkmk
Commit: 34a79dc12af31a36ff5dd6271a13af7fabc84e3b
https://github.com/tribe29/checkmk/commit/34a79dc12af31a36ff5dd6271a13af7fa…
Author: Sergey Kipnis <sergey.kipnis(a)tribe29.com>
Date: 2022-03-08 (Tue, 08 Mar 2022)
Changed paths:
M cmk/gui/plugins/wato/check_parameters/filesystem.py
M cmk/gui/plugins/wato/check_parameters/utils.py
Log Message:
-----------
Make parameter for some transform_xxx function immutable
This change fixes the issue "transform_value() for ruleset
'filesystem' altered input" that was reported during
"omd update".
CMK-9769
Change-Id: I491d2bfd003d67c3736a44884a72d4df9c6493bd
Branch: refs/heads/2.0.0
Home: https://github.com/tribe29/checkmk
Commit: 6febe2381ce1e344b4dcaefa64d07e21e976541b
https://github.com/tribe29/checkmk/commit/6febe2381ce1e344b4dcaefa64d07e21e…
Author: Joerg Herbel <joerg.herbel(a)tribe29.com>
Date: 2022-03-08 (Tue, 08 Mar 2022)
Changed paths:
A .werks/13758
R checks/ipmi_sensors
R cmk/base/check_legacy_includes/ipmi_common.py
R cmk/base/check_legacy_includes/ipmi_sensors.py
M cmk/base/config.py
A cmk/base/plugins/agent_based/ipmi_sensors.py
M tests/unit/checks/test_generic_legacy_conversion.py
R tests/unit/checks/test_ipmi_sensors.py
A tests/unit/cmk/base/plugins/agent_based/test_ipmi_sensors.py
Log Message:
-----------
13758 FIX ipmi_sensors: Fix crash due to incomplete IPMI data
This change migrates the legacy plugin ipmi_sensors.
CMK-9879
Change-Id: I48caa2c1bc9bf24cbed3bf3f8bae4e6be2933747
Branch: refs/heads/master
Home: https://github.com/tribe29/checkmk
Commit: 5f154c4504362cf0fecb410454b062c7761f5a26
https://github.com/tribe29/checkmk/commit/5f154c4504362cf0fecb410454b062c77…
Author: Joerg Herbel <joerg.herbel(a)tribe29.com>
Date: 2022-03-08 (Tue, 08 Mar 2022)
Changed paths:
A .werks/13758
R checks/ipmi_sensors
R cmk/base/check_legacy_includes/ipmi_common.py
R cmk/base/check_legacy_includes/ipmi_sensors.py
M cmk/base/config.py
A cmk/base/plugins/agent_based/ipmi_sensors.py
M tests/unit/checks/test_generic_legacy_conversion.py
M tests/unit/cmk/base/plugins/agent_based/test_ipmi_sensors.py
Log Message:
-----------
13758 FIX ipmi_sensors: Fix crash due to incomplete IPMI data
This change migrates the legacy plugin ipmi_sensors.
CMK-9879
Change-Id: I48caa2c1bc9bf24cbed3bf3f8bae4e6be2933747
Commit: 384def8d653e5aa15bc2f76db923ca15e5eb5269
https://github.com/tribe29/checkmk/commit/384def8d653e5aa15bc2f76db923ca15e…
Author: Max Linke <max.linke(a)tribe29.com>
Date: 2022-03-08 (Tue, 08 Mar 2022)
Changed paths:
M cmk/special_agents/agent_gcp.py
M tests/unit/cmk/special_agents/test_agent_gcp.py
Log Message:
-----------
Add asset section to gcp api integration
We replace the different APIs to get information about gcs,functions,
and run with a single asset section. This section collects information
about any resource currently created in the project. We can use this
information later to add more labels to our services.
Change-Id: Ia3d1882bb2229031190d769bd2dbb1bef0928410
Commit: dc687d860ed1b73a91c97a0b6e47e733074dee7f
https://github.com/tribe29/checkmk/commit/dc687d860ed1b73a91c97a0b6e47e7330…
Author: Sergey Kipnis <sergey.kipnis(a)tribe29.com>
Date: 2022-03-08 (Tue, 08 Mar 2022)
Changed paths:
M agents/cmk-agent-ctl/src/monitoring_data.rs
M agents/wnx/src/engine/external_port.cpp
M agents/wnx/src/engine/external_port.h
M agents/wnx/watest/test-external-port.cpp
Log Message:
-----------
Use correct remote IP address from win-conroller
This CL provides agent with real IP address of the remote
peer. The solution is not final, API will be improved and
cleaned in the next commit.
Logic:
- immediately after connect controller sends remote ip addr
as text in established TCP connection
- upon accepting connect agent reads all data up to 1 second
if _connection is local_. Data obtained are assumed as a peer
address
TEST: unit-with-io, manual with log file check
CMK-9929
Change-Id: Iff25fd30c5b89e0be03df3730587d1dc2fe90242
Commit: 5449df984f148129d19df2bcf1dacc47e9ca3e3d
https://github.com/tribe29/checkmk/commit/5449df984f148129d19df2bcf1dacc47e…
Author: Lukas Lengler <lukas.lengler(a)tribe29.com>
Date: 2022-03-08 (Tue, 08 Mar 2022)
Changed paths:
M cmk/gui/plugins/dashboard/graph.py
Log Message:
-----------
Show maximum metrics error message in dashlets
The "Sorry, you cannot have more than 100 metrics in a combined graph."
error message was only visible in var/log/web.log when creating a
dashlet.
Now you the error message is displayed in the dashlet.
Change-Id: Ifb55d8914eebead0dcfa6a21dd3e2cca93698839
Compare: https://github.com/tribe29/checkmk/compare/5fce3290c2ab...5449df984f14